Williams target maintaining 3rd place for 2016

Grove based Williams F1 have told F1 Hub that their aim for the 2016 F1 season is to maintain third place in the constructors championship, like they did in 2015.  Whilst Williams made a ‘huge' revival after their back-running return to Formula 1, Claire Williams admits the team must not get stuck on their achievements […] The post Williams target maintaining 3rd place for 2016 appeared first on F1 Hub.
